KSP Charges Calloway Co. Man With Child Sexual Exploitation Offenses

Murray, Ky. (May 22, 2019) On May 22, 2019, the Kentucky State Police Electronic Crime Branch arrested Corey Ray Hubbs, 51, on charges related to distribution of matter portraying sexual performance by a minor.

Hubbs was arrested as the result of an undercover Internet Crimes Against Children investigation. The KSP Electronic Crime Branch began the investigation after discovering the suspect sharing files of child sexual exploitation online.

The investigation resulted in the execution of a search warrant at a residence in Murray on May 22, 2019. Equipment used to facilitate the crime was seized and taken to KSP’s forensic laboratory for examination. The investigation is ongoing.

Hubbs is currently charged with twenty-two counts of distribution of matter portraying sexual performance by a minor 1st offense. Each charge is a Class-D felony punishable by one to five years in prison. He was lodged in the Calloway County Jail.
